Excel VBA快速复制单元格区域编程实例
版权申诉
49 浏览量
更新于2024-10-14
收藏 16KB ZIP 举报
资源摘要信息: "本压缩包文件包含了Excel VBA宏编程的实例源代码,专门用于演示如何快速复制指定单元格区域。该资源对于掌握Excel中的VBA编程非常有帮助,特别适合那些希望提高办公自动化效率的用户。VBA(Visual Basic for Applications)是Microsoft Office应用程序的内置编程语言,通过它可以开发自定义的自动化任务,从而提高工作效率和精确度。"
Excel VBA(Visual Basic for Applications)是一种在Microsoft Office应用程序中使用的编程语言,它允许用户通过编写宏来自动化许多复杂的任务,特别是在处理电子表格和数据管理方面。以下是对该资源中可能涉及的知识点的详细说明:
1. Excel VBA宏编程基础:
- VBA的开发环境(VBE)介绍:包括如何打开VBA编辑器,查看项目资源管理器,以及代码窗口的使用。
- VBA语法基础:讲解VBA的关键字,变量声明,数据类型,运算符,控制结构(如条件语句和循环语句)。
2. 操作Excel工作簿和工作表:
- 工作簿的打开、保存、关闭等操作。
- 工作表的选择、添加、删除、重命名等基本操作。
- 引用单元格和区域:通过单元格地址(例如A1,B2:C5)或命名范围进行操作。
3. 编写复制单元格区域的宏:
- 使用Range对象:介绍如何使用Range对象选择要复制的数据区域。
- 使用Copy方法:详细解释如何使用Copy方法进行数据复制。
- 指定目标位置:讲解如何定义复制的目标位置,可能是同一个工作表内的另一个位置,或者是不同工作簿的工作表。
- 处理跨工作簿操作:涉及跨工作簿复制时的工作簿引用和路径问题。
4. 错误处理和调试技巧:
- 常见错误的识别和处理,例如错误的范围引用。
- 使用调试工具(如断点、单步执行、监视窗口等)来诊断和修复代码中的问题。
5. 用户界面交互:
- 简单的用户表单设计,用于获取用户输入的复制目标位置。
- 消息提示和警告信息的输出,例如使用MsgBox函数。
6. 示例源代码分析:
- 详细解读压缩包中的.xlsm文件内的VBA代码,分析代码结构和逻辑。
- 说明代码如何在实际工作中应用,包括复制操作的触发方式(例如按钮点击)。
7. 实际应用中的注意事项:
- 宏安全性设置:确保宏只在安全的环境下运行。
- 性能优化:避免宏运行时占用过多资源或运行缓慢的问题。
- 兼容性问题:确保宏代码在不同版本的Excel中能够正常运行。
8. 办公自动化解决方案:
- 如何将编写好的宏应用到日常工作中,提高工作效率。
- 常见的办公自动化场景举例,例如数据整理、报告生成、邮件合并等。
通过掌握这些知识点,用户能够更加高效地使用Excel进行数据处理和分析,进一步提升个人或团队的工作效率。此外,熟悉VBA编程还有助于个人技能的提升,为未来可能的职业发展提供支持。
2023-03-18 上传
2022-12-13 上传
2023-03-18 上传
2022-12-13 上传
2022-12-13 上传
2022-12-14 上传
2022-12-14 上传
2022-12-14 上传
2022-12-14 上传
芝麻粒儿
- 粉丝: 6w+
- 资源: 2万+
最新资源
- Labs
- Mission-to-Mars
- trimngo/polyphantom:实现“逼真的分析多面体 MRI 模型”-matlab开发
- 解析器:Telecraft的默认解析器,支持Vanilla和PaperMC服务器!
- 一杯咖啡
- 大气的商务幻灯片下载PPT模板
- Pusula Gazetesi Manşet Haberleri-crx插件
- python办公自动化相关基础教程
- flatland:二维白板地图实用程序
- Helios-frontend:Helios项目的前端
- 黑色城堡背景的万圣节活动策划PPT模板
- Yazarx Extension-crx插件
- ponce-admin:Ponce-Admin
- 公路桥梁隧道施工组织设计-钢便桥工程施工组织设计方案
- 添加到 mat:轻松地将变量添加到 .mat 文件(如有必要,请创建)。-matlab开发
- 黑色商务人士背景下载PPT模板